Pascal是一种通用的,面向对象的,基于对象的程序设计语言,被广泛应用于各种领域,包括科学计算,软件工程,游戏开发等。Pascal经典案例可以帮助我们了解Pascal语言的应用和特点。
pascal是系统软件吗以下是一个Pascal经典案例:Pascal语言在气象学中的应用。
在这个案例中,Pascal语言被用来处理大量的气象数据,包括温度、湿度、气压、风速等。这些数据需要被存储、检索、分析和可视化,以便更好地理解气候变化和预测天气。
具体来说,Pascal程序的任务是:
1. 接收和处理来自气象站的大量实时数据。
2. 存储这些数据,以便后续的分析和可视化。
3. 生成可视化的图表和图像,以便更好地理解气候变化。
程序的设计和实现:
首先,我们需要定义数据类型来存储气象数据。这可能包括温度、湿度、气压和风速等变量。然后,我们可以创建一个类来表示气象数据集,包括数据集的名称、日期、时间、以及每个变量的值。
接下来,我们需要编写一个函数来接收和处理新的气象数据。这个函数应该能够接收新的数据集,并将其存储在数据库中。这个数据库可以是文件系统中的一个文本文件,也可以是一个关系数据库管理系统(如MySQL或PostgreSQL)中的一个表格。
然后,我们需要编写一个函数来检索和处理历史数据。这个函数应该能够根据日期和时间检索数据集,并对其进行必要的处理和分析。这可能包括计算平均值、标准差、相关性等统计指标。
最后,我们需要编写一个函数来生成可视化的图表和图像。这个函数应该能够使用Pascal的绘图库(如Graph或TeeChart)来绘制图表和图像,并将它们保存为图像文件。这些图像文件可以被用于展示和理解气候变化。
这个程序可能需要一些外部库的支持,例如用于接收和处理数据的网络库(如WinSock),
用于存储和检索数据的数据库库(如SQLite),以及用于绘制图表和图像的绘图库(如Graph)。
通过这个案例,我们可以看到Pascal语言在处理大量数据和生成可视化图表方面的强大能力。同时,这个案例也展示了Pascal面向对象的特点,通过类和对象来组织和处理数据。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论